X14Osaka is known as the city of "kuidaore" which translates as eating oneself to financial ruins. You will find this mantra really true in Dotombori. There are stalls serving hot steaming takoyaki and restaurants with colorful neon lights that allure you to Osakan treats such as okonomiyaki (grilled savory pancake), kushikatsu (deep fried skewers), fugu (puffy fish) and kani (crab).
This gourmet strip is easy to spot as the over-the-top, 3-D signs including Glico Running Man and Kani Doraku Crab welcome you at the south entrance. The walkways along a canal (Dotombori-gawa) that runs parallel to the street is a good place to stroll after dinner.

X19Shinsaibashi is a premier shopping arcade running north-south in the Minami district, one of Osaka's two major retail centers. About 600m long, this pedestrian street provides a wide selection of choices from high-end department stores, both international and Japanese brands such as H&M and Uniqlo, chain stores, kimono shops, boutiques, the 100-yen shop, pharmacies, restaurants, cafes and fresh-from-the-griddle crepes.
As this strip is sheltered from the elements, it is a great escape from a rainy day or a scorching summer day. The southern end meets the Dotonbori River, Osaka's well-known gourmand area. It is recommended that you get off at Namba Station, walk northward through this arcade, and take the train at Shinsaibashi Station instead of walking all the way back.

X38Universal Studios Japan (USJ) , located in the Osaka Bay Area, is a theme park featuring a variety of movie-related rides and shows. Opened in March 2001, USJ attracted ten million visitors faster than any other theme park in the world.
The theme park offers exciting rides about Back to the Future, Jurassic Park, Jaws, Spider Man and other blockbuster Hollywood movies. The attractions also include characters from Sesame Street, Snoopy (Peanuts) and Peter Pan, and you will definitely meet the friendly Woodpecker couple and Pink Panther wandering around as main costumed characters. Read More informationLocated next to the Osaka Aquarium, this three-story complex accommodates a diversity of shops, restaurants and amusement facilities. Among the most popular is the Naniwa Kuishimbo Yokocho ('Osaka gourmand alley'), a retro-looking 1960s-1970s food mall serving takoyaki, okonomiyaki, grilled squids, cutlet skewers and other Osaka treats. For those with kids, a pool with large slides and a pet garden featuring dogs, cats and rabbits are a pleasant experience. Cruise boats looping around the bay depart at a nearby pier.

X27America Mura, also know as Ame-Mura, is a youth-focused retail and entertainment area near Shinsaibashi in the Minami district of Osaka. In 1970s, the blocks formerly bristled with warehouses turned into a retail center of second-hand clothes, records and accessories imported from the US west coast and Hawaii, thus called "America Village" by mass media.
In addition to hip, offbeat shops with unique merchandising, this retail space is a good spot to observe the latest fads of Japanese teens, as well as pleasant monuments and artistic objects. A sleepless haunt of youngsters, Ame-Mura is busy with bars and nightclubs, attracting hordes of wannabe musicians, designers and dancers at night.

X8This castle was originally built in 1583 for Toyotomi Hideyoshi as a symbol of unification of Japan and was the largest castle at the time. In the 1620s, the ruling Tokugawa family reconstructed the castle and added watch towers and stone walls. The present reinforced concrete structure of the castle keep dates back to 1931 and miraculously survived the WWII air raids.
The castle keep is similar in design to that of Himeji Castle and surrounded by a huge garden area with expansive moats. The entrance level floor now has a threater that plays videos about the history. The top floor offers a panoramic view of the city. The illumination of the castle is also stunning after dark. It is warned that you can take an elevator to the 6th floor but have to climb stairs down all the way.
Osaka castle is one of the biggest and well-known castles in Japan. It sits on the hill of "houenzaka" and attracts so many visitors from all over the world because of its magnificent size and beauty. The inside of the main tower has been completely renovated and turned into a museum where historically valuable items are exhibited. You can learn the history of the castle and appreciate its presence. During the cherry blossom season(usually early April), you can see the castle from the osakajou park(Osaka castle park) where over 200 cherry trees are in full blossom.
